In this article, we'll explore the world of GLP-1 friendly desserts that not only satisfy your sweet cravings but also support your weight loss goals and overall health. **Understanding GLP-1 and Its Role in Weight Loss** GLP-1, or Glucagon-Like Peptide-1, is a naturally occurring hormone that plays a crucial role in regulating appetite, blood sugar, and digestion. When taken as a medication, GLP-1 receptor agonists like Ozempic, Wegovy, or Mounjaro can help with weight loss and improve blood sugar control. Fresh Berry Parfait
* 1 cup fresh ber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ries) * 6 oz Greek yogurt * 1 tablespoon honey or coconut sugar * 1/4 cup chopped almonds Layer fresh berries, Greek yogurt, and chopped almonds in a glass or bowl. Drizzle with honey or coconut sugar for a sweet and satisfying treat.2. Dark Chocolate Avocado Mousse
